Job Description

Job Summary:

The Regional Vice President - Land Development will oversee the development of assigned divisions, ensuring the achievement of business objectives. This role requires a strong leader with exceptional inter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Guide and support divisions to develop leaders within division teams to support the Region's business plans and goals
  • Travel to assigned divisions to establish relationships with each team and understand their respective markets and projects
  • Understand land and lot acquisition strategy within assigned division markets
  • Support business plan development of assigned divisions and oversee assigned divisions' performance against business plans
  • Provide business input and review deal flow prior to Region President or COO review
  • Oversee the development of organizational plans for assigned division operations and associated functions
  • Review organizational plans in advance of Region President or Executive review
  • Provide counsel, guidance, and coaching to assigned divisions; guide management staff in developing their personal management capabilities and professional skills
  • Assist them in personal development planning and appraise their progress
  • Attend operational meetings as required
  • Implement and maintain region procedures
  • Review operations and performance of assigned divisions. Takes corrective action as deemed necessary to achieve goals.
  • Help facilitate business review meetings of applicable divisions identifying areas requiring corrective action and assign responsibility and specific commitment dates
  • Recognize talent, recruit, retain, and motivate a team across all functions to help assigned divisions run a successful operation
  • Monitor market, identify trends, and help assigned divisions to react timely
  • Oversee tasks as assigned by the Region President or COO
  • Conduct all business in a professional and ethical manner to serve customers and increase the goodwill and profit of the company

Supervisory Responsibilities:

Supervises 2 or more employees

Required Qualifications:

  • Master's degree or equivalent, or ten to twelve years related experience
  • Must have a vehicle and a valid driver's license
  • Basic accounting or finance knowledge
  • Possess a strong managerial and leadership background, providing a successful record of setting, establishing, and meeting goals
  • Possess exceptional inter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to train, mentor, and motivate
  • Demonstrate problem-solving skills by using persistence and ability
  • Ability to apply common sense understanding to carry out instructions furnished in written or oral form
  • Proficiency with MS Office

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ience in a leadership role involving operations, sales, and production preferred
  • Experience in land acquisition and residential lot development a plus
  • Ability to conduct and analyze product and market analysis. Strong understanding of sales, pricing strategies, and cash flow preferred
